For almost seventy years there was a bottle mail under the banks of the Rhine in Oberwesel. After construction workers had accidentally freed them, a search for traces began.
A menu, an old address and a bit of detective work: The mystery of the bottle mail in Oberwesel is aired. Who is the author?
A bottle mail, which was thrown into the river Rhine almost 70 years ago, has now been discovered. The author is still alive – and can hardly remember the message she threw off board a ship at a young age. The search for the senior was like a detective work. In 1958 the message was scribbled on a menu and thrown into the Rhine in a green glass bottle. Recently, the bottle mail reappeared during construction work on the banks of Oberwesel – and t…
It was 1958 when a young woman (22) threw a special message overboard a ship.
